AOBSA demands change in BPUT examination pattern

Bhubaneswar, Sep 13 (UNI) The All Orissa BPUT Students Association (AOBSA) today demanded a change in the examination pattern of bachelor in technology and till than the year back system be abolished.

AOBSA convener Subhashi Mishra and Sashank Mishra told newsmen here that over 10,000 students of different classes of B tech discipline in the private engineering colleges in Orissa have suffered immensely due to the year back system imposed by the Biju Pattnaik University of Technology (BPUT).

They alleged that the examination fixture, the publication of the results and the evaluation of papers of the BPUT had to be improved and streamlined.

And till then the BPUT should introduce a promotion system for all the students till the fourth year and then provide the provisional certificates so that the students selected in the campus interview would be suitably employed.

The students leader said it was highly irrational and illogical not to promote the students to 4th year with a single back paper in the first year.

They also alleged that the examination papers were evaluated by the teachers whose academic proficiency were in doubt as they were just passed out of the college and appointed as teachers to evaluate the papers.

The AOBSA demanded that the current year examination result should be cancelled immediately and a revaluation be done by competent teachers at the earliest.

The BPUT students, who staged a demonstration in the capital city last week, demanding the abolition of the year back system, went on a rampage uprooting the iron fencing in the master canteen square and damaging scores of vehicles before being dispersed following police action.
